Victor Wooten and The Wooten Brothers Announce Fall Tour
This will be the brothers’ first tour together as a band since the untimely death of their saxophone-playing brother Rudy a few years ago
Victor Wooten and The Wooten Brothers have expanded their forthcoming tour into November, adding ten new stops to an already jam-packed fall lineup. The group, which features lifelong collaborators and real-life brothers Victor , Joseph , Roy “Futureman , ” and Regi Wooten , recently announced its highly anticipated reunion tour commencing in September. Following a nearly two-week run in the southeast with New Orleans jazz-funk titans Rebirth Brass Band , The Wooten Brothers are set to appear in several midwestern markets including St. Louis, Indianapolis, Ann Arbor, Minneapolis, and more. All tour dates are listed below.
Lauded by Rolling Stone as one of the “ Top 10 Bassists of All Time ,” Victor Wooten has captivated audiences for over four decades with his dynamic stage presence and unparalleled technical chops. Wooten’s eclectic repertoire includes collaborations with the likes of Béla Fleck and the Flecktones (of which he is a founding member), Chick Corea , Dave Matthews Band , India Arie , Keb’ Mo’ , and more recently, Cory Wong . Widely regarded as one of the greatest living bassists today, Wooten continues to share his passion for music through numerous modalities. The multidisciplinary artist has authored two books and has mentored thousands of students at his own Center for Music and Nature since the year 2000.
Remarkably accomplished in their own right, each of the Wooten brothers bring a unique flavor to the live experience. Joseph Wooten , also known as the “Hands of Soul,” has been the keyboardist/vocalist for the Steve Miller Band since 1993 and is a renowned composer, arranger, author, and motivational speaker whose collaborations include work with Whitney Houston , George Clinton , and Kenny G . Roy “Futureman” Wooten is also a founding member of Béla Fleck and the Flecktones and a five-time GRAMMY award winner who is famously known for his trademark inventions the “Drumitar” and the “RoyEI” keyboard. A philosopher, researcher, filmmaker, and educator, Roy’s impressive solo career, symphonic works, and “ Black Mozart ” projects span the genres of classical, jazz, soul, gospel, and spoken word. Regi Wooten ’s signature guitar style of chording, slapping, tapping and virtuosic strumming has earned him world-wide notoriety and comparisons to Jimi Hendrix, Frank Zappa and Chuck Berry. In recent years, Regi has performed with many artists including the legendary Ginger Baker . Known worldwide as “The Teacha,” Regi currently teaches music in Nashville, TN and has taught many notable musicians.
Together The Wooten Brothers bring an uncanny level of experience, originality and expertise to the stage. Playing together since childhood, the formidable group has shared stages with the likes of Curtis Mayfield , The Temptations , Ramsey Lewis , Stephanie Mills , War , and others. Fans can expect an infectious, colorful, and exuberant production that showcases The Wooten Brothers’ impenetrable creative chemistry. An amalgam of original songs and choice classics, each show offers a one of a kind adventure that defies the bounds of jazz, funk, soul, R&B, rock, and bluegrass.
On the forthcoming tour, Victor shares, “Being in a band with my brothers is the best thing for me. It’s like a family reunion every time we get together to play. They are my teachers and I feel most at home with them.”
This will be the brothers’ first tour together as a band since the untimely death of their saxophone-playing brother Rudy a few years ago. In the forthcoming year, The Wooten Brothers will release their first studio album in several decades.
“The music we are working on at the moment is a collection of new and old. We have songs that were recorded decades ago that have never been heard by anyone. We also have newer music that was recorded over the last year. It will be a nice collection of old and new. With the older music, we want to introduce the world to Rudy, our saxophone playing brother who passed away in 2010. Be prepared to have your mind blown.”

General Admission Standing Room with Limited Seating Victor, bass guitar/vocals; Joseph, keyboards/vocals; Roy, percussion/vocals; and Regi, guitars/vocals. For over four decades the Wooten Brothers have been recognized as some of the most innovative musicians in existence and are collectively known as one of the most talented and dynamic band of brothers the world has ever known. Since they were young, the five brothers have been a musical tour-de-force redefining the limits of jazz, funk, soul, R&B, rock, and bluegrass. Sons of military parents, their early years were spent living in different states including Hawaii, California, and Virginia where they shared stages with the likes of Curtis Mayfield, The Temptations, Ramsey Lewis, Stephanie Mills, War, and other artists. In the mid 80’s, the brothers released an album as The Wootens for Clive Davis’ Arista Records. This will be the brother’s first tour together as a band since the untimely death of their saxophone-playing brother Rudy a few years ago.
Victor Wooten, a five-time Grammy Award-winning artist, has graced the cover of Bass Player Magazine five times. He is a founding member of the eclectic group Bela Fleck and the Flecktones and is recognized as one of the greatest living bassist today often drawing comparisons to Jaco Pastorius, and was named one of the “Top ten bassist of all time”by Rolling Stone Magazine. He is also an award-nominated author, naturalist, and music educator and has been running his unique music/nature camps since the year 2000. Wooten’s camps are held at his own Wooten Woods, which is just outside of Nashville. In 2010, he started his own record label, Vix Records, which has released a series of acclaimed recordings over the last few years.
Joseph Wooten has a dizzying list of talents that is impressive even by the Wooten clan’s standards. Currently the keyboardist for the Steve Miller Band (since 1993), he is also a composer, orchestrator, motivational speaker, and has been showcased as an amazing vocalist since he was a child. In 1981, Joseph became known as the “overnight accordion player” when he literally auditioned, bought an accordion, and began performing within a matter of a few days for the Busch Gardens amusement park in Williamsburg, VA. He has collaborated with the likes of Whitney Houston and Kenny G, and when not touring with Miller, leads his own band, performs with Freedom Sings, and even helps out his little brother as keyboardist, vocalist, and composer for The Victor Wooten Band. Roy “Futureman” Wooten, also a five-time Grammy Award winner, is best known for his masterful drumming and percussion skills and is a founding member Bela Fleck and the Flecktones. Roy, a seasoned drum set player, is mostly known for his frenzied, inimitable on-stage performances heightened by his surreal choice of instruments: his trademark inventions “The Drumitar” and “RoyEl” keyboard. He is also a philosopher, researcher, filmmaker, and educator. His impressive solo career and “Black Mozart” projects scan the genres of classical, jazz, soul, gospel, and spoken word.
Regi Wooten’s signature guitar style of chording, slapping, tapping and frenzied strumming has earned him world-wide notoriety and comparisons to Jimi Hendrix, Frank Zappa and Chuck Berry. In recent years, Regi has performed with many artists including the legendary Ginger Baker. Regi, known worldwide as “The Teacher”, currently teaches music in Nashville, TN and has taught many notable musicians. He was teaching his little brothers Joseph and Victor when he himself was only 9 years old. One of his early, but lasting contributions was the composition of his and his brother’s high school Alma Mater.

The Wooten Brothers Preview First Album In Decades With “Sweat” [Video]
Victor Wooten and The Wooten Brothers have shared a video for their new single, “Sweat”, the title track from their upcoming first album in decades, and it’s just as funky as you’d expect. The single arrives ahead of the brothers highly anticipated reunion tour , which kicks off tonight in Chattanooga, TN.
Led by world-renowned bassist and educator Victor Wooten, The Wooten Brothers combine the talents of keyboardist Joseph Wooten , a.k.a. the “Hands of Soul,” Roy “Futureman” Wooten , known for his trademark inventions the “Drumitar” and the “RoyEI” keyboard, and Regi Wooten , known worldwide as “The Teacha”. The brothers started playing together as children but have each gone on to pursue their own careers in music. Now they are reuniting for their first collaborative album and tour in many years, and for the first time since the passing of their sax-playing brother Rudy Wooten in 2010.
“Being in a band with my brothers is the best thing for me,” Victor Wooten said when the reunion tour was announce earlier this year. “It’s like a family reunion every time we get together to play. They are my teachers and I feel most at home with them.
“The music we are working on at the moment is a collection of new and old,” he added. “We have songs that were recorded decades ago that have never been heard by anyone. We also have newer music that was recorded over the last year. It will be a nice collection of old and new. With the older music, we want to introduce the world to Rudy, our saxophone playing brother who passed away in 2010. Be prepared to have your mind blown.”
Listen to “Sweat” by The Wooten Brothers below. The song will debuted by the band at the tour opener in Chattanooga and will be available on streaming platforms on Friday, September 29th. Sweat the album is due for release in 2024.
